摘要

Besides its direct impact on infants' health, breastfeeding enhances other child survival interventions and could help save 1 million infant lives in developing countries every year. The monograph, the fourth in a series, examines the behavioral aspects of breastfeeding, weaning, and nutrition and their importance for project design and implementation. Major issues covered include: (1) beliefs, practices, and other important factors affecting feeding practices, nutrition, and child survival; (2) health providers and institutions and their effects on feeding practices; (3) infant and child nutrition interventions both at the community level and in health institutions; (4) the process of sustaining and expanding nutrition programs; and (5) qualitative research methods useful for examining behavioral aspects of infant and child feeding.
